How to Fix Common Login Errors on Fountain Casino Instantly
Clear your browser cache and cookies–right now. I’ve seen three people in a row get stuck on the “invalid session” screen because they never cleared their old data. It’s not a fix, it’s a band-aid. But it’s the first thing that actually works. Open your browser settings, find the privacy section, and wipe everything from the last 30 days. No exceptions. You’re not losing anything valuable–just old login tokens that are probably corrupt.
Try a different browser. I switched from Chrome to Edge and the error vanished. Not because Edge is better, but because Chrome was holding onto a stale authentication token. I’ve had this happen twice in a row–same account, same device, same password. The moment I opened the site in Firefox, I was in. (No joke. I swear I saw the loading bar go green faster.) If you’re using mobile, try switching from Safari to Chrome or vice versa. It’s not about the browser’s speed–it’s about how it handles session storage.
Check your device’s time and date settings. Seriously. I spent 45 minutes troubleshooting a login loop until I noticed my phone’s clock was off by 27 minutes. The server rejected the handshake because the timestamp didn’t match. (I was like, “Wait… what?”) Go to Settings > General > Date & Time and turn on “Set Automatically.” If it’s off, even by a minute, you’re not getting in. No amount of password resets will fix that. It’s not a bug–it’s a security feature. And yes, I’ve seen this happen on a MacBook, a tablet, and a Samsung Galaxy. Don’t skip this step. It’s the silent killer.
